From 6d8952f9da8e846a79467297c0972c46cbbd1e51 Mon Sep 17 00:00:00 2001 From: edX requirements bot Date: Sun, 16 Nov 2025 19:31:40 -0500 Subject: [PATCH] chore: Upgrade Python requirements --- requirements/base.txt | 10 +++++----- requirements/ci.txt | 6 +++--- requirements/dev.txt | 24 ++++++++++++------------ requirements/doc.txt | 14 +++++++------- requirements/pip-tools.txt | 4 ++-- requirements/quality.txt | 18 +++++++++--------- requirements/test.txt | 14 +++++++------- 7 files changed, 45 insertions(+), 45 deletions(-) diff --git a/requirements/base.txt b/requirements/base.txt index 5ed171eb..eafec234 100644 --- a/requirements/base.txt +++ b/requirements/base.txt @@ -10,11 +10,11 @@ asgiref==3.10.0 # via django attrs==25.4.0 # via -r requirements/base.in -billiard==4.2.2 +billiard==4.2.3 # via celery celery==5.5.3 # via -r requirements/base.in -certifi==2025.10.5 +certifi==2025.11.12 # via requests cffi==2.0.0 # via @@ -22,7 +22,7 @@ cffi==2.0.0 # pynacl charset-normalizer==3.4.4 # via requests -click==8.3.0 +click==8.3.1 # via # celery # click-didyoumean @@ -84,9 +84,9 @@ pyjwt[crypto]==2.10.1 # via # drf-jwt # edx-drf-extensions -pymongo==4.15.3 +pymongo==4.15.4 # via edx-opaque-keys -pynacl==1.6.0 +pynacl==1.6.1 # via edx-django-utils python-dateutil==2.9.0.post0 # via celery diff --git a/requirements/ci.txt b/requirements/ci.txt index 8f506120..7045d67b 100644 --- a/requirements/ci.txt +++ b/requirements/ci.txt @@ -4,11 +4,11 @@ # # make upgrade # -cachetools==6.2.1 +cachetools==6.2.2 # via tox chardet==5.2.0 # via tox -click==8.3.0 +click==8.3.1 # via import-linter colorama==0.4.6 # via tox @@ -20,7 +20,7 @@ filelock==3.20.0 # virtualenv grimp==3.13 # via import-linter -import-linter==2.5.2 +import-linter==2.6 # via -r requirements/ci.in packaging==25.0 # via diff --git a/requirements/dev.txt b/requirements/dev.txt index 7bb7129b..1bd12562 100644 --- a/requirements/dev.txt +++ b/requirements/dev.txt @@ -23,7 +23,7 @@ backports-tarfile==1.2.0 # via # -r requirements/quality.txt # jaraco-context -billiard==4.2.2 +billiard==4.2.3 # via # -r requirements/quality.txt # celery @@ -31,13 +31,13 @@ build==1.3.0 # via # -r requirements/pip-tools.txt # pip-tools -cachetools==6.2.1 +cachetools==6.2.2 # via # -r requirements/ci.txt # tox celery==5.5.3 # via -r requirements/quality.txt -certifi==2025.10.5 +certifi==2025.11.12 # via # -r requirements/quality.txt # requests @@ -55,7 +55,7 @@ charset-normalizer==3.4.4 # via # -r requirements/quality.txt # requests -click==8.3.0 +click==8.3.1 # via # -r requirements/ci.txt # -r requirements/pip-tools.txt @@ -105,7 +105,7 @@ cryptography==46.0.3 # secretstorage ddt==1.7.2 # via -r requirements/quality.txt -diff-cover==9.7.1 +diff-cover==9.7.2 # via -r requirements/dev.in dill==0.4.0 # via @@ -203,7 +203,7 @@ idna==3.11 # via # -r requirements/quality.txt # requests -import-linter==2.5.2 +import-linter==2.6 # via # -r requirements/ci.txt # -r requirements/quality.txt @@ -241,7 +241,7 @@ jinja2==3.1.6 # -r requirements/quality.txt # code-annotations # diff-cover -keyring==25.6.0 +keyring==25.7.0 # via # -r requirements/quality.txt # twine @@ -307,7 +307,7 @@ pathspec==0.12.1 # via # -r requirements/quality.txt # mypy -pip-tools==7.5.1 +pip-tools==7.5.2 # via -r requirements/pip-tools.txt platformdirs==4.5.0 # via @@ -374,11 +374,11 @@ pylint-plugin-utils==0.9.0 # -r requirements/quality.txt # pylint-celery # pylint-django -pymongo==4.15.3 +pymongo==4.15.4 # via # -r requirements/quality.txt # edx-opaque-keys -pynacl==1.6.0 +pynacl==1.6.1 # via # -r requirements/quality.txt # edx-django-utils @@ -391,7 +391,7 @@ pyproject-hooks==1.2.0 # -r requirements/pip-tools.txt # build # pip-tools -pytest==9.0.0 +pytest==9.0.1 # via # -r requirements/quality.txt # pytest-cov @@ -440,7 +440,7 @@ rich==14.2.0 # twine rules==3.5 # via -r requirements/quality.txt -secretstorage==3.4.0 +secretstorage==3.4.1 # via # -r requirements/quality.txt # keyring diff --git a/requirements/doc.txt b/requirements/doc.txt index f31e96b9..bbfcc0b1 100644 --- a/requirements/doc.txt +++ b/requirements/doc.txt @@ -24,13 +24,13 @@ babel==2.17.0 # sphinx beautifulsoup4==4.14.2 # via pydata-sphinx-theme -billiard==4.2.2 +billiard==4.2.3 # via # -r requirements/test.txt # celery celery==5.5.3 # via -r requirements/test.txt -certifi==2025.10.5 +certifi==2025.11.12 # via # -r requirements/test.txt # requests @@ -43,7 +43,7 @@ charset-normalizer==3.4.4 # via # -r requirements/test.txt # requests -click==8.3.0 +click==8.3.1 # via # -r requirements/test.txt # celery @@ -156,7 +156,7 @@ idna==3.11 # requests imagesize==1.4.1 # via sphinx -import-linter==2.5.2 +import-linter==2.6 # via -r requirements/test.txt iniconfig==2.3.0 # via @@ -233,15 +233,15 @@ pyjwt[crypto]==2.10.1 # -r requirements/test.txt # drf-jwt # edx-drf-extensions -pymongo==4.15.3 +pymongo==4.15.4 # via # -r requirements/test.txt # edx-opaque-keys -pynacl==1.6.0 +pynacl==1.6.1 # via # -r requirements/test.txt # edx-django-utils -pytest==9.0.0 +pytest==9.0.1 # via # -r requirements/test.txt # pytest-cov diff --git a/requirements/pip-tools.txt b/requirements/pip-tools.txt index e97cb1b3..383d2a06 100644 --- a/requirements/pip-tools.txt +++ b/requirements/pip-tools.txt @@ -6,11 +6,11 @@ # build==1.3.0 # via pip-tools -click==8.3.0 +click==8.3.1 # via pip-tools packaging==25.0 # via build -pip-tools==7.5.1 +pip-tools==7.5.2 # via -r requirements/pip-tools.in pyproject-hooks==1.2.0 # via diff --git a/requirements/quality.txt b/requirements/quality.txt index a7eb1df4..b88fc2a5 100644 --- a/requirements/quality.txt +++ b/requirements/quality.txt @@ -20,13 +20,13 @@ attrs==25.4.0 # via -r requirements/test.txt backports-tarfile==1.2.0 # via jaraco-context -billiard==4.2.2 +billiard==4.2.3 # via # -r requirements/test.txt # celery celery==5.5.3 # via -r requirements/test.txt -certifi==2025.10.5 +certifi==2025.11.12 # via # -r requirements/test.txt # requests @@ -39,7 +39,7 @@ charset-normalizer==3.4.4 # via # -r requirements/test.txt # requests -click==8.3.0 +click==8.3.1 # via # -r requirements/test.txt # celery @@ -155,7 +155,7 @@ idna==3.11 # via # -r requirements/test.txt # requests -import-linter==2.5.2 +import-linter==2.6 # via -r requirements/test.txt importlib-metadata==8.7.0 # via keyring @@ -181,7 +181,7 @@ jinja2==3.1.6 # via # -r requirements/test.txt # code-annotations -keyring==25.6.0 +keyring==25.7.0 # via twine kombu==5.5.4 # via @@ -271,15 +271,15 @@ pylint-plugin-utils==0.9.0 # via # pylint-celery # pylint-django -pymongo==4.15.3 +pymongo==4.15.4 # via # -r requirements/test.txt # edx-opaque-keys -pynacl==1.6.0 +pynacl==1.6.1 # via # -r requirements/test.txt # edx-django-utils -pytest==9.0.0 +pytest==9.0.1 # via # -r requirements/test.txt # pytest-cov @@ -319,7 +319,7 @@ rich==14.2.0 # via twine rules==3.5 # via -r requirements/test.txt -secretstorage==3.4.0 +secretstorage==3.4.1 # via keyring semantic-version==2.10.0 # via diff --git a/requirements/test.txt b/requirements/test.txt index 11d96179..4f9bc007 100644 --- a/requirements/test.txt +++ b/requirements/test.txt @@ -14,13 +14,13 @@ asgiref==3.10.0 # django attrs==25.4.0 # via -r requirements/base.txt -billiard==4.2.2 +billiard==4.2.3 # via # -r requirements/base.txt # celery celery==5.5.3 # via -r requirements/base.txt -certifi==2025.10.5 +certifi==2025.11.12 # via # -r requirements/base.txt # requests @@ -33,7 +33,7 @@ charset-normalizer==3.4.4 # via # -r requirements/base.txt # requests -click==8.3.0 +click==8.3.1 # via # -r requirements/base.txt # celery @@ -129,7 +129,7 @@ idna==3.11 # via # -r requirements/base.txt # requests -import-linter==2.5.2 +import-linter==2.6 # via -r requirements/test.in iniconfig==2.3.0 # via pytest @@ -179,15 +179,15 @@ pyjwt[crypto]==2.10.1 # -r requirements/base.txt # drf-jwt # edx-drf-extensions -pymongo==4.15.3 +pymongo==4.15.4 # via # -r requirements/base.txt # edx-opaque-keys -pynacl==1.6.0 +pynacl==1.6.1 # via # -r requirements/base.txt # edx-django-utils -pytest==9.0.0 +pytest==9.0.1 # via # -r requirements/test.in # pytest-cov